The Basics of Quantum AI
To grasp the implications of quantum AI investment, it is essential to understand the foundational elements that form its core. Quantum AI combines principles from quantum physics and computer science, creating an entirely new paradigm for processing information. By utilizing quantum bits, or qubits, quantum computers can represent and manipulate vast amounts of data simultaneously, vastly outperforming classical computers in specific tasks.
The unique capability of quantum computers lies in their ability to exist in multiple states at once, allowing them to solve complex problems more efficiently than traditional systems. For example, unlike classical algorithms that execute sequentially, quantum algorithms can evaluate numerous possibilities simultaneously, leading to quantum speedup in problem-solving. The implications of this technology stretch into diverse industries such as finance, healthcare, and cybersecurity, fundamentally altering their operational frameworks.

How Quantum AI Works
Quantum AI operates on two fundamental principles: superposition and entanglement. Superposition allows qubits to exist in multiple states at once, enhancing computational power. For instance, while a classical bit can represent either a 0 or 1, a qubit can simultaneously represent both, exponentially increasing the amount of data processed. This feature is particularly beneficial in scenarios requiring large-scale optimization, such as logistics and finance.
Entanglement is another critical principle that underpins quantum AI. When qubits become entangled, the state of one qubit can depend on the state of another, no matter the distance apart. This interdependence enables quantum computers to function as a cohesive system, enabling rapid communication and processing across multiple qubits. Risks and Challenges of Investing in Quantum AI
Despite the compelling potential of quantum AI investment, investors must navigate various risks and challenges inherent in this booming industry. One primary concern is the technical complexity surrounding quantum technology, which may deter traditional investors unfamiliar with this space. Understanding quantum mechanics and its application in AI necessitates a level of expertise that not all investors possess.
Furthermore, the technology is still nascent, resulting in uncertainty regarding which companies will ultimately succeed. The competitive landscape is also evolving, making it vital for investors to stay informed about ongoing developments. As firms iterate on their products and services, instability and potential disruptions within the sector may occur. Investors must adopt a cautious approach while assessing opportunities in such a tumultuous environment.
